House, now flats. c1740 with late C18 or early C19 additions,           converted late C20. Narrow brick in Flemish bond with some           painted stone dressings. Slate roof.           EXTERIOR: 3 storeys and 4 bays. The facade has a stone plinth           to the 2 left-hand bays, 2 brick storey bands, painted stone           sill bands to the ground and first floor, and a modillion           gutter cornice. A straight joint suggests that the 2           right-hand bays are an addition. The windows are glazing bar           sashes and have segmental brick arches on the ground and first           floors. The doorway, to the right of the 2nd bay, is recessed           within an opening which has a semicircular arch of rubbed           bricks. The reveals are lined with timber and there is a           semicircular overlight with leaded glazing. The door has 2           glazed panels above 4 raised and fielded panels. Chimneys at           left and to right of 2nd bay.           INTERIOR: not inspected.           (An Inventory of the Historical Monuments in the City of York:           RCHME: Outside the City Walls East of the Ouse: London: 1975-:           66).
